FineMark National Bank & Trust Boosts Stock Position in Bank of America Co. (NYSE:BAC)

FineMark National Bank & Trust raised its stake in Bank of America Co. (NYSE:BAC) by 6.7% during the 4th quarter, HoldingsChannel reports. The firm owned 100,919 shares of the financial services provider’s stock after acquiring an additional 6,314 shares during the period. FineMark National Bank & Trust’s holdings in Bank of America were worth $4,435,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Bank of America Stock Performance

Shares of BAC opened at $43.09 on Tuesday. Bank of America Co. has a 52-week low of $34.15 and a 52-week high of $48.08. The firm has a market capitalization of $327.57 billion, a PE ratio of 13.38, a P/E/G ratio of 1.21 and a beta of 1.32. The firm has a 50-day moving average price of $44.77 and a 200 day moving average price of $43.83. The company has a quick ratio of 0.78, a current ratio of 0.78 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.04.

Bank of America (NYSE:BACG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, January 16th. The financial services provider reported $0.82 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.77 by $0.05. The business had revenue of $25.30 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$25.12 billion. Bank of America had a net margin of 14.10% and a return on equity of 10.29%. The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 15.0%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$0.70 earnings per share. On average, sell-side analysts anticipate that Bank of America Co. will post 3.7 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Bank of America Dividend Announcement

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, March 28th. Stockholders of record on Friday, March 7th will be issued a $0.26 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, March 7th. This represents a $1.04 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.41%. Bank of America’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 32.30%.

Bank of America Company Profile

(Free Report)

Bank of America Corporation, through its subsidiaries, provides banking and financial products and services for individual consumers, small and middle-market businesses, institutional investors, large corporations, and governments worldwide. It operates in four segments: Consumer Banking, Global Wealth & Investment Management (GWIM), Global Banking, and Global Markets.
